Brainerd was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their sixth straight loss. They were a single set away from ending the streak, but they lost a 2-1 heartbreaker at the hands of the Duluth East Greyhounds. The Warriors were not able to make up for their defeat to the Greyhounds from their previous meeting back in September of 2024.

Brainerd's loss shouldn't obscure the performances of Bella Goggleye, who had six digs and two blocks, and Sophia White, who had seven digs and three aces. Goggleye has been hot, having also posted 13 or more assists the last five times she's played.
Brainerd's defeat dropped their record down to 1-12. As for Duluth East, they now have a winning record of 5-4.
Coincidentally, Brainerd and Duluth East will both be playing Irondale the next time they take the court. The Greyhounds will head out to face the Knights at 11:15 a.m. on Saturday, while the Warriors will play them later in the day, at 7:00 p.m.
